Times have changed in those 20-something years, and I’m pleased to have had the opportunity to review the Rockabye Baby CD – Lullaby Renditions of Aerosmith.
Rockabye Baby is a record label that releases a line of CDs which turn popular rock bands into lullaby music for babies and parents.
…the label was born of the need to make children’s music cool–not only for babies but for their parents too.
The have lullaby renditions of 25 rock artists including The Beatles, Nirvana, AC/DC, Queen and their most recent album which is about to be released on September 15, 2009 – Lullaby Renditions of Aerosmith which features liner notes by Steven Tyler.
When we played this for Slugger, my one-year old grandson, he immediately reacted with interest to the tunes! As a grandparent, what I liked was listening to the familiar popular music that is now remixed as a lullaby!

I’ve recently had the opportunity to review a beautiful, designer infant car seat cover from Baby Bella Maya. My grandchildren are now able to travel not only in style, but in comfort. I received the Toddler COUTURE in Ocean Mist, which could be used for either a boy or girl. I really liked the satin-sheen finish and intricate details on the designs. The piping along the edge of the car seat cover is evidence that this is a quality product.
Moms today are fortunate to have so many fashionable and trendy options available to them compared to when I was a young mom.
Baby Bella Maya offers parents a safety benefit not available on other car seat covers: snaps. The covers add style to infant carriers, but in the safest possible way. No need to remove the straps repeatedly in order to keep car seat covers clean. The snaps allow for easy access that does not require removing the car seat’s straps. Simply slide straps through the inserts, snap it up and you are ready to go. Canopies available with trim and ruffle, matching seatbelt pads included.
The covers are made of woven polyester blends and are available in fun animal prints to the luxurious woven damasks. The cover was designed to fit the Britax Marathon car set, however it should fit most other most major brands.
Recommended Cleaning: Hand Wash, cool water, lay flat to dry

I surprised ‘Lil Moomette, my 20-month old granddaughter when I picked her up from day care, and we experimented with the puzzle together. This is a terrific first wooden puzzle that encourages creative play. The puzzle pieces are just the right size for little toddler hands to grasp and have matching pictures underneath.
Each barnyard animal is covered in soft felt so as to stimulate the sense of touch, feel & imagination in your child.

The puzzle itself measures 0.51″ x 9″ x 12″ assembled. The animals include a cow, duck, lamb and pig.
What I liked about this toy is that it helped ‘Lil Moomette to identify her colors, facial features (ears, eyes, nose, mouth) as well as feet and tail! Moomette was able to practice learning to identify a fence, water (swim swim), butterfly, flowers & more. The puzzle packed quite a bit of creativity into one activity toy!
When the pieces are removed, there are facsimiles underneath to help your child put the pieces back in the proper place.
The wooden puzzle is hand-crafted, and all the edges were very smooth, with no rough edges for little fingers. No worries there!
Recommended Ages: 1+ year(s)
